After replacing the windshield does anything need to be done with the sensors under the mirror(recalibrate)? Trying to decide which company can handle the job without issue.

Had mine replaced with OEM glass through Safelite. Highly recommended- they do the calibration to the camera if necessary and it costs an additional $300. My truck did not require it according to the computer system they hooked up to it and it works perfectly.

I had Safelite replace my windshield with an OEM and they had to recalibrate after. It was very seamless. I drove around town with the installer until his computer showed 100% completed.
